Aren't DR Hi Beam (45 65 85 105 125) too thing for tuning down one step ? Especially the B string.
I have a Warwick Streamer LX . I think the scale is 34"
If these aren't suitable for down tuning, what do you recommend ?
would definetly say so especially on the B, you will need something with a heavier guage, onlong the lines of 0.135 for the B if not more.
The fact that you are on a 34 scale is also not going to work in your favour as the lower you try to go in tuning the higher the guage you will need and the bigger your scale will need to
